Red Bull recently took their newly decommissioned 2013 RB7 Formula 1 race car to a military airstrip in Australia where it met with an F/A-18 Hornet belonging to the Royal Australian Air Force.
Behind the Red Bull F1 car was their new driver, Australian Daniel Ricciardo, while the jet was flown by pilot Michael Keightley. The result of the ‘race' is not surprising, with the F1 car taking the lead off the line, but getting beaten at the finish line by the jet.
